如题目,在使用MiniProg4对CY4532 EVK的CYPD317芯片进行programming时,出现报错(出现错误之前,已经成功烧写几次了),具体情况如下:
对于该问题,我进行了如下的排查:
1.确认连接接口是否正确-------连接接口与之前可以成功烧写的连接状态一致;
2.供电来源---采用Miniprog4供电,无外接电源,main borad 跳线口 J6 连接状态为1-2(vtarg -VDD);
3.Miniprog4 固件状态已经更新到最新:firmware version 2.10.878;
4.电脑usb设备状态:
注:之前使用发现无法使用CCG4芯片去更新CCG3PA芯片固件,因此又购买了MiniProg4 下载器,没想到还没使用了超过1天,又问题了。。。。
这是之前关于该设备的问题无法下载固件的讨论:CAN't find CYPD3171 of CY4532-EVK main board
已解决! 转到解答。
Hi,
那这个可能是硬件上损坏的问题了。MiniProg4一般是不会坏的。
你可以量一下芯片的VDDD GND管脚与MiniProg的连接,SWD_IO SWD_CLK到地的阻抗,确认芯片是否工作正常。VDDD VCCD在供电时电平是否处在正常范围。
Hi,
我拔下来,也试过了,也不行,会出现同样的error;
我把power borad的J8调试口也焊接上连接口后,使用Miniprog4去CYPD4126进行烧写,也会出现同样的error;
我想是不是芯片坏了,但是发生可以用EZ-PD config Utility 通过USB 串行接口对CYPD4126芯片更新固件,但是无法使用Miniprog4;
然后我又怀疑是不是miniprog4坏了,然后有又使用Psoc program工具对Miniprog4更新固件,发现也是可以成功更新固件了。
你这connector应该选5pin才对
miniprog4好像选不了,连接上以后,软件会默认设置的。
Hi,
那这个可能是硬件上损坏的问题了。MiniProg4一般是不会坏的。
你可以量一下芯片的VDDD GND管脚与MiniProg的连接,SWD_IO SWD_CLK到地的阻抗,确认芯片是否工作正常。VDDD VCCD在供电时电平是否处在正常范围。
Hi,这是我对CYPD 3171芯片进行了测试:
1.供电3.3V时,VDD 3.12V,VCCD 1.8V;
2.电阻 VDD、SWD_IO、SWD_CLK对地电阻均大于1M以上;